An opportunity to acquire this charming semi-detached two-bedroom cottage requiring a course of updating throughout, boasting a great size well maintained garden, parking and summer house plus also benefits from Planning in Principle for a single dwelling within the grounds.
Hailglower is situated in the popular hamlet of St Levan with the famous open Minack Theatre and Porthcurno Beach approximately one mile distant, along with the picturesque rugged coastline.

* Price Information
Guides are provided as an indication of each Seller’s minimum expectation. They are not necessarily figures at which a property will sell for and may change at any time prior to Auction. Unless stated otherwise, each Lot will be offered subject to a reserve (a figure below which the Auctioneer cannot sell the Lot during the Auction).
We expect the reserve will be set within the guide range or no more than 10% above a single figure guide. Please check our website regularly at cliveemson.co.uk, or contact us on 01622 608400, in order to stay fully informed with the up-to-date information.
